Cardiovascular Classes: These are your go-to for burning calories and boosting heart health. Think high-energy sessions like Zumba, which is a fantastic fusion of dance and aerobic exercise, or cycling/spinning classes that offer a challenging, sweat-inducing ride. HIIT (High-Intensity Interval Training) classes are also a staple, perfect for those short on time but looking for maximum impact. These classes involve short bursts of intense activity followed by brief recovery periods, torching calories even after the workout is done. Strength and Conditioning: If building muscle, improving endurance, or toning up is your goal, these classes are for you. You might find boot camp-style sessions that combine cardio with strength exercises, dedicated weightlifting classes, or functional training that mimics everyday movements. Pilates and some forms of yoga also fall into this category, focusing on core strength, flexibility, and controlled movements. These classes are crucial for developing a well-rounded physique and boosting your metabolism.
-
Mind-Body Classes: For those seeking balance, stress relief, and improved flexibility, mind-body classes are essential. Yoga is a cornerstone here, with various styles like Vinyasa (flow), Hatha (foundational), and Restorative (gentle stretching and relaxation). Pilates, as mentioned, also strongly emphasizes core strength and body awareness. These classes are not just about physical fitness; they're about connecting your mind and body, promoting mindfulness, and reducing stress. They're a perfect complement to more intense workouts.

Arrive Early: Seriously, this is a game-changer. Aim to get to the studio at least 10-15 minutes before the class starts. This gives you time to settle in, find a good spot (especially important in classes like yoga or Pilates where your position matters), chat with the instructor, and get your equipment ready. It also helps you mentally transition into workout mode, reducing any pre-class jitters.

Communicate with Your Instructor: Don't be shy! Let the instructor know if you're new to the class, have any injuries or physical limitations, or if you're pregnant. They are there to help you modify exercises and ensure you're working out safely and effectively. A good instructor will appreciate the heads-up and can offer personalized guidance throughout the session.
-
Listen to Your Body: This is paramount. While it’s great to push yourself, never ignore pain. Modify exercises as needed, take breaks when you feel fatigued, and remember that consistency beats intensity in the long run. It's better to reduce the intensity for a session and come back stronger next time than to injure yourself and be sidelined.
-
Stay Hydrated: Bring a water bottle and sip throughout the class, especially during high-intensity workouts. Dehydration can lead to fatigue, dizziness, and decreased performance. Ivy Fitness Center likely has water fountains available, but having your own bottle is always convenient.
-
Wear Appropriate Gear: Make sure you're dressed comfortably and appropriately for the type of class. This includes supportive footwear, breathable clothing, and any specific gear mentioned in the class description (like grippy socks for yoga or cycling shoes for spin). Feeling comfortable in your attire allows you to focus on the workout itself.
-
Fuel Smartly: Eat a light, easily digestible snack or meal about 1-2 hours before your class, especially if it's a longer or more intense session. Avoid heavy meals right before exercising. Post-workout, refuel with a balanced meal or snack containing protein and carbohydrates to aid muscle recovery.
-
Be Present and Engaged: Put your phone away (unless needed for a timer or specific app guidance) and immerse yourself in the experience. Focus on the instructor's cues, your breath, and the movements. This mindfulness not only enhances the workout's effectiveness but also makes it more enjoyable and helps in stress reduction.
-
Cool Down and Stretch: Don't skip the cool-down period at the end of the class. This helps your heart rate gradually return to normal and can prevent muscle soreness. Gentle stretching afterwards further improves flexibility and aids recovery.
